About the Role

We are seeking a dynamic and strategic Technical Recruiter to drive and elevate our internal hiring processes. As the face of internal talent acquisition, you will lead the development and execution of innovative recruiting strategies to identify, attract, and retain top talent across all departments.

This is a hybrid role based in London, with two/three in‑office days per week.

Please note: 12 Month FTC

Key Responsibilities

  • Partner with the internal talent acquisition function with a focus on quality, efficiency, and candidate experience.
  • Partner with department heads and hiring managers to understand current and future hiring needs and develop proactive hiring plans.
  • Build and maintain an internal mobility strategy to identify and develop internal talent pipelines.
  • Champion diversity, equity, and inclusion throughout the recruitment process.
  • Oversee end‑to‑end recruitment processes from intake to offer, ensuring consistency and compliance with hiring policies.
  • Optimise and scale internal referral programs and talent marketplace platforms.
  • Own and continuously improve recruiting KPIs (e.g. time‑to‑fill, quality‑of‑hire, internal promotion rate).
  • Act as a trusted advisor to hiring managers, providing guidance on role scoping, interview best practices, and selection.
  • Facilitate strong collaboration between People Ops, L&D, and Business Units for seamless internal transitions.
  • Provide regular hiring updates and data‑driven insights to leadership.
  • Manage and leverage our Applicant Tracking System (ATS) and other recruitment tools to improve process efficiency.
  • Use analytics to inform decision‑making and identify bottlenecks in the hiring funnel.
  • Help drive AI innovation within the team.

Required Qualifications

  • 3+ years of experience in Talent Acquisition.
  • Proven success in managing full‑cycle recruitment across a variety of functions.
  • Strong understanding of internal mobility, succession planning, and talent pipeline development.
  • Excellent communication, stakeholder management, and interpersonal skills.
  • Experience with ATS and HRIS platforms; data‑driven decision‑making approach.
